<i>FKRP</i> gene mutations cause congenital muscular dystrophy, mental retardation, and cerebellar cysts
25 Mar 2003
Abstract excerpt
BACKGROUND: Congenital muscular dystrophies (CMD) are autosomal recessive disorders that present within the first 6 months of life with hypotonia and a dystrophic muscle biopsy. CNS involvement is present in some forms. The fukutin-related protein gene (FKRP) is mutated in a severe form of CMD (MDC1C) and a milder limb girdle dystrophy (LGMD2I).
